How to Reverse Data in Excel: Step-by-Step Guide

Learn how to easily reverse rows in Excel in just a few simple steps.

45 views

To reverse data in Excel, follow these steps: 1. Select the column with your data. 2. Right-click and choose 'Insert'. 3. Number the new column sequentially (1, 2, 3, etc.). 4. Select both columns and click 'Data' -> 'Sort'. 5. Choose the number column and select 'Largest to Smallest'. Your data will now be reversed.

  1. Can I reverse data in Excel without a helper column? No, using a helper column is the most straightforward method to reverse data effectively in Excel.
  2. What is the quickest way to sort data in Excel? Highlight your data and use the sort feature under the Data tab for quick sorting based on your needs.
  3. Are there Excel functions for data manipulation? Yes, Excel includes various functions like SORT and FILTER that can aid in data manipulation without traditional sorting methods.
